404 Error ページを思うようにカスタマイズ100%講座
Joomlaの404エラーページは、事務的な印象を与えるためもっと気の利いたページにしたいというニーズがJoomlaユーザーにある。
これから紹介する404エラーページを100%カスタマイズする方法は、一般ユーザーにはちょっとだけ難しいかもしれないが・・・やれるかも。
最終的にこんなイメージの404エラーページを作成してみたい。現物のページは、http://goyat.jp/asfdsadf にアクセスすれば見れる。
カスタマイズ ステップ1
新しいページを未分類カテゴリに設定して作成する。コンテンツは、自由に書いて下さい。画像だけでも良いし、検索機能を表示しても良い。好きなようにページを作成して下さい。
カスタマイズ ステップ1-1
検索の対象にならないようにクローラーを受け付けない設定をする。
カスタマイズ ステップ2
メニュー管理で新しいメニュー:hiddenmenuを作成する
カスタマイズ ステップ3
hiddenmenuに単一記事のメニュー「Sorry!お探しのページは見つかりませんでした」を作成する。選択する記事は、最初に作成したError 404 Pageにする。
カスタマイズ ステップ4(FTPでファイルを修正)
templates/YourTemplate/system/error.phpをテキストEditorで開いて赤で囲ったコードを追加する。矢印のindex.php?で続くURLは、ステップ3で取得したリンクURLを記入する。ファイルは、必ず、UTF-8フォーマットで保存してFTPする。
コード:
if (($this->error->getCode()) == '404') {
header('Location: /index.php?option=com_content&view=article&id=xxx');
exit;
}
id=xxxにページ番号が入る。
この時点で99%404エラーページのカスタマイズが完了する。
試しに、自分のサイトにhttp://あなたのサイト/xxxxxxxと記入してアクセスしてみて下さい。404エラーページが表示されるはずだ。
表示された404エラーページのページタイトル左上に注目してほしい。
下記は別のサイトの事例で「記事」が表示されている。同じようにあなたのサイトの404エラーページも「記事」を表示しているはずだ。
新しい記事の掲載時にメールで同じ内容を配信します。
お問合せフォーム